Tiger Woods agreed to a plea deal Wednesday in a Florida case stemming from a rollover crash earlier this year, resulting in a five-year suspension of his driver’s license and a warning from a judge that any violation could land him back behind bars. Woods appeared in Martin County court, where prosecutors and defense attorneys reached an agreement that reduced some of the original allegations tied to the March incident, ESPN reported.
